Alpine Visitors Centre Tour - This is a great tour if you wish to cover all 3 ecosystems. We start in the lower valley and get you right up to the Alpine Visitors Centre at 11,796 feet. You will encounter breathtaking views, but remember to layer up and bring warm clothes as there is usually snow at the top year round. We get you to the areas most people drive past and give you extra time at each stop for photos. Tours are interpretive and we leave you with memories that will last a lifetime.

This tour was absolutely stunning. We spotted and photographed elks, marmots, bighorn sheep, and countless chipmunks. The tour started with visiting Alluvial Fan (cascade/waterfall). Then, we headed to Alpine Visitor Center stopping multiple times at spectacular viewpoints. The trip is a great opportunity to experience tundra (I highly recommend taking a short hike from Alpine Visitor Center during free time there). We had a fantastic guide, Ben, who kept us entertained throughout the trip. He is very knowledgeable and shared with us many interesting facts about the park and its flora and fauna.
